What Problems Do Traditional Training Methods Face?
Traditional insurance training methods are time-consuming, costly, and unscalable, relying on static lectures and generic tests that fail to prepare agents for live interactions.
Instructor-led sessions take weeks to cover content, with competency assessed via methods that don't reflect high-stakes scenarios like liability assessments or claim resolutions. Costs escalate due to limited scalability, and consistency varies across regions, exacerbating turnover.[1][3]
Without mobile accessibility or analytics, tracking ROI becomes impossible, and young agents disengage from non-interactive formats. This results in prolonged ramps to productivity, with new hires needing months to handle complex products effectively.[1]
How Does AI Solve Insurance Training Challenges?
AI solves insurance training challenges through content generation, roleplay simulations, analytics, and mobile delivery, creating practical, measurable learning at scale.
AI content generators produce customized sessions from company documents, including multilingual videos with avatars for global teams. Dynamic simulations offer human-like conversations, adapting to responses for skills in sales, underwriting, and compliance.[1][3]
Analytics centers provide actionable feedback and ROI metrics, while mobile platforms enable on-the-go training without logins. PwC data shows AI training cuts new hire time by 30%, with platforms like SmartWinnr offering regulation-aware templates for quick launches.[3]
Feature | Traditional Training | AI-Powered Training |
|---|---|---|
Scalability | Limited to classroom sizes (50-100 agents) | Unlimited, simultaneous access for thousands |
Personalization | Generic modules | Tailored to roles, personas, multilingual |
Feedback | Delayed, subjective | Real-time, data-driven |
Training Time | Weeks to months | Reduced by 30%[3] |
Cost | High (instructors, venues) | Low, automated |
